TL431AIDCKTG4 Precision Programmable Reference
The TL431AIDCKTG4 from Texas Instruments is a highly versatile three-terminal adjustable shunt regulator with specified thermal stability over applicable automotive, commercial, and military temperature ranges. This precision programmable reference device is designed to offer both performance and flexibility, making it suitable for a wide array of applications.
With an output voltage range of 2.495 V to 36 V and a typical temperature coefficient of only 50 ppm/°C, the TL431AIDCKTG4 ensures a stable reference under varying conditions. The device features a low output noise, which is essential for precision electronics, and can source up to 100 mA of output current. Additionally, it boasts a typical dynamic output impedance of 0.22 Ω, providing excellent transient response.
The TL431AIDCKTG4 comes in a compact SC-70 package, which is ideal for space-constrained applications. Its small footprint does not compromise its performance, making it an excellent choice for integration into high-density circuit boards. The device's pinout is designed for ease of use, with the reference input, cathode, and anode clearly marked to simplify circuit design.
Applications for the TL431AIDCKTG4 are diverse and include adjustable voltage and current references, voltage monitoring, and precision current limiters. It is also commonly used in switch-mode power supplies, linear power supplies, and battery chargers, where accurate reference voltages are crucial for optimal performance.
